Default Have Sport Nav - but TMC-RDC doesn't work? Help!

We picked up our 58 Sport Nav + Lux Pack 3 weeks ago and absolutely love it! I can't stress that enough. Bit of a change from out Renault Scenic...

The only issue we have is that the TMC-RDC (traffic) feature doesn't pick up any channels. I queried this with the dealership and they have just got back to me saying that
the RDC -TMC was never enabled at the factory. It cannot be enabled retrospectively either so we will have to live without it! Apparently there was a problem with the licenses from Japan.

Is this correct? Is it unreasonable to assume having Sat Nav means having a working traffic feature?

I'd love to hear if anyone else with the Sat Nav has this feature working, or had any other experiences with their dealer.

Hi Beccie

Basically, Mazda haven't subscribed to the TMC feature in the UK. It will work in some countries where the TMC is free but not here. I would say that this is a feature which should work as nowhere in any brochures could I find that it shouldn't work but, to be honest I couldn't be bothered to fight it.

I believe that, in theory, if you buy your new (latest) UK map in the UK you will be supplied with a UK map with the TMC license incorporated/enabled. I suppose the logic is ...why should users of this globally available car pay for TMC license in their UK map that they may well never use? TMC is available free in many countries, but not free in the UK. But if this is true you must be absolutely sure that the UK map update/upgrade you are going to buy (or get free as a curtesy upgrade as you usually get 1 or 2 upgrades with map software) that the TMC is enabled. If they, the seller, don't know it means it doesn't. If it was a selling feature they should and would know.

Note: The GPS software used must support TMC
RDS-TMC is only available in:
Austria.
Belgium.
Czech Republic.
Denmark.
Finland.
France.
Germany.
Italy.
Netherlands.
Norway.
Spain.
Sweden.
Switzerland.
United Kingdom and the US.

I know that in UK and France it's not free but i think some is free in France though. This is information from nearly 2 years ago. The list may be bigger now adding Hungary & Romania I suspect.
